以下是解决"AngularJS应用程序不起作用"的一些常见问题和解决方法的示例代码:
检查AngularJS库是否已正确加载:
确保ng-app指令已正确应用到HTML元素上:
确保ng-controller指令已正确应用到HTML元素上:
-
检查AngularJS模块是否已正确定义:
var myApp = angular.module('myApp', []);
-
检查控制器是否已正确定义:
myApp.controller('myCtrl', function($scope) {
// 控制器逻辑
});
-
检查ng-model指令是否正确应用到表单元素上:
-
检查ng-click指令是否正确应用到按钮或链接上:
-
确保在AngularJS应用程序之外的脚本中没有使用全局的$rootScope对象:
// 错误示例
function myFunction($rootScope) {
// ...
}
// 正确示例
function myFunction($scope) {
// ...
}
-
检查浏览器的开发者控制台是否有任何错误消息或警告,修复其中的问题。
如果以上解决方法仍然无法解决问题,建议在问题描述中提供更多详细信息,以便更准确地帮助解决这个问题。
相关内容